Where Is Classico Pasta Sauce Manufactured

The products are made at plants in Pennsauken, N.J., and Northbrook, Ill. Borden officials said the 350 employees who work at the plants will be offered jobs with Heinz.

Why is there a shortage of Classico alfredo sauce?

KITCHENER People searching for Alfredo sauce at local stores might be out of luck. Valerie Johnston needed a jar to make shrimp fettuccine, but there was none to be found. I went down the pasta aisle where all the sauces are and that portion of the shelf was empty, she said.

  • Johnston searched two other stores, but still wasnt successful.
  • I thought it was really weird when I went to the second and third store, she said.
  • Somethings up with this. Johnston was finally able to snag two jars.
  • Shes not alone in her search.
  • Some other local residents have posted about the shortage on social media.
  • Simon Somogyi, a food supply expert, said companies are limiting production due to the pandemic. Theyre prioritizing flavours that we like to eat and that typically, in the case of pasta sauce, is marinara, he said. Kraft Heinz makes 63 different Classico pasta sauces.

    • Eight of those are Alfredo.
    • Chief Administrative Officer Av Maharaj said theyve reduced sauce types in order to increase overall volume.
    • Its more efficient to make fewer products, but more of those, than many products and fewer, he explained.
    • He said the company is producing 9,000 more cases a month than it was before the pandemic.

    CREAMY ALFREDO SAUCE RECIPE, ONE OF MY FAVORITE ITALIAN

    FromCuisineCategoryServingsTotal Time

    • Heat a large saucepan over high heat until very hot. Add just enough cold water to cover the bottom of the pan. Let the water evaporate but make sure there are a few drops left in the pan. This will keep the cream from scorching and burning on the bottom of the pan. Remove the pan from the heat.
    • Add the cream to the pan and return it to the heat. When the cream comes to a boil, reduce heat to medium/ medium high and continue to boil until it is reduced by half. During that time, add the garlic.
    • In the meantime, cook pasta in well salted water according to package directions. Drain well when cooked.
    • When the cream is reduced remove it from the heat. Add butter 1 tablespoon at a time and whisk it in. The cream should thicken and turn glossy. Add the cheese and hot pasta to the cream. Season with salt and pepper and garnish with chopped fresh parsley. Serve immediately .

    What Is In Sundried Tomato Alfredo Sauce

    • Cream- Heavy whipping cream works great for this. You can also sub half and half, it just may not be as rich and creamy.
    • Chicken Broth- Use your favorite.
    • Sun-Dried Tomatoes- You can use dehydrated sun-dried tomatoes or sun-dried tomatoes packed in olive oil. Either will work great. We like to blend the tomatoes but you can slice them into small chunks or whatever your family likes.
    • Parmesan Cheese- Shredded parmesan or grated parmesan works great.
    • Garlic Salt- The perfect blend to flavor your alfredo sauce. No need for minced garlic. Use garlic powder and a little salt in place of garlic salt.
    • Nutmeg- Just a pinch will do. It adds tons of depth and flavor.
    • Pepper- just a pinch here too.

    How To Make Tomato Alfredo Sauce

  • In a large pot on the stove, bring the cream to a boil. Boil for 1-2 minutes.
  • In a blender, blend together the chicken broth and the sun-dried tomatoes until smooth.
  • Add the sun-dried tomato mixture to the cream and add the parmesan cheese, garlic salt, nutmeg, and the pepper.
  • Bring the mixture back up to a boil stirring constantly.
  • Add your sauce to some freshly cooked pasta, steamed vegetables or use as a dipping sauce for your favorite breadsticks.

    Oil Packed Vs Dry Sundried Tomatoes

    Sun-dried tomatoes are always in my pantry these days. For this recipe, I use dry sun dried tomatoesnot the kind packed in oil. I buy them from Whole Foods or Trader Joes, and they are great in cream sauces like this because of how much flavor they add to a dish.

    Youll find sun dried tomatoes two ways in the supermarketdry or packed in oil. Both are great, however for WW purposes, I use dry since they are zero points. The oil packed ones are unbelievably delicious because, well, oil.

    Dry packed sun dried tomatoes need to be rehydrated. They are chewy like dried fruit, but unlike dried fruit, they are zero points. Cooking them in the cashew milk rehydrates them while infusing the cashew milk with the bright, tomato flavor.

    You can use the oil in a marinade or salad dressing, but my favorite way to use them is to add both tomatoes and oil to fresh pasta with a little bit of cheese. The tomatoes packed in oil are preserved differently so they are good to go right away, and can be easily added to salads, pastas, etc.

    Fettuccine Alfredo With Chicken & Broccoli

    Serve up this Fettuccine Alfredo with Chicken & Broccoli tonight! This creamy pasta is made up of penne pasta, chicken, fresh broccoli, a four cheese alfredo sauce, parmesan cheese and more. Our Fettuccine Alfredo with Chicken & Broccoli is easy to make and your family will love every bite!

    Provided by My Food and Family

    1-1/2 cups small broccoli florets
    4 small boneless skinless chicken breasts
    1 Tbsp. olive oil
    1/4 tsp. ground black pepper
    1 cup CLASSICO Four Cheese Alfredo Pasta Sauce
    2 Tbsp. KRAFT Shredded Parmesan Cheese

    Steps:

    • Cook pasta in large saucepan as directed on package, omitting salt and adding broccoli to the boiling water for the last 3 min.
    • Meanwhile, brush chicken with oil sprinkle with pepper. Cook in large nonstick skillet on medium heat 5 to 6 min. on each side or until done . Remove from heat.
    • Cook pasta sauce in medium saucepan on medium-low heat 5 min. or until heated through, stirring frequently. While sauce is cooking, cut chicken into thin strips.
    • Drain pasta mixture place in large bowl. Add pasta sauce mix lightly. Top with chicken and cheese.

    Nutrition Facts : Calories 440, Fat 12 g, SaturatedFat 4.5 g, TransFat 0 g, Cholesterol 90 mg, Sodium 480 mg, Carbohydrate 0 g, Fiber 3 g, Sugar 0 g, Protein 35 g

    How To Make Sun Dried Tomato Pasta

    Sun
    • Cook pasta. Cook pasta on the stove in salted water according to package instructions until al dente. Reserve ¼ cup of pasta water . Drain water from the pasta and add sun dried tomato oil to keep it from sticking.
    • Make the sauce. While the pasta is boiling, prepare the sauce. Heat butter, shallots, and garlic in a large skillet over medium heat. Let simmer until the shallots are translucent. Add thyme, oregano, black pepper and crushed red pepper and stir to combine.
    • Add remaining sauce ingredients. Turn the heat down to low. Add half & half and slowly warm up. Add half of the pasta water. Allow the mixture to heat slowly, but dont allow it to simmer. Add the pesto. Slowly add the Parmesan in small increments, until completely melted together.
    • Tosstogether. Add fettuccine and mix until combined. Toss chopped tomatoes and lemon juice in with the pasta. Serve immediately. Add fresh parsley to the top for serving if youd like.
